I was told to appear for an interview for a USA company and was asked to subscribe for their services for which i paid 3370 Rs and then they said i need to give security amount of 12000 otherwise my process wont be complete. They said it will be flagged payment and it will be back to my account in 1-2 days, then they again asked for 11000 rupees twice,As i was already feeling cheated I had no option but in a hope that process will be complete and I will get my money back, I did all the payment like an idiot.I have never seen any such payments procedure where they take so much amount as security. Now they are saying tomorrow I will get all the details about my interview and all, Also they are assuring me that I will get the money back in 1-2 days. They are still in contact and picking my call every time I try but how do i believe them. I am totally confused, I do not care about the job but I am worried about my 40,000 rupees which is like very huge amount. Please help me with this. i am very sad, all was my hard money :(
